Safety And Security Requirements for Pet Dog Daycare
The very best way to keep pets safe at pet dog daycare is by having the ideal business techniques in place. These consist of a clear customer process and team guidelines on just how to handle hostile or unwell animals.



The ideal safety and security standards likewise entail separating canines by size, power degree, and play style to avoid problems. Other essential security attributes include having kennel spaces and regular examinations.

Safety Enclosures
When pet dogs are cost-free to play in the same room, it is very important they have the ability to do so safely. Solid fence, a staging area for brand-new pets to acclimate, and separating the varying dimensions and personalities of the dogs in a playroom are all good security criteria.

Additionally seek staff to be trained in canine body movement and habits, and to make use of tools like a calming voice and tethered pheromones to deescalate aggressive or afraid behaviors. And if any type of pet dogs get ill during their remain, personnel must have the ability to inform proprietors specifically what's going on and take them to the veterinarian immediately.

Numerous Obstacles
I'm constantly careful of standard pet dog day cares that do not utilize several barriers to keep escaped dogs from running loose. They should contend the very least 2 doors between the play area and outside, plus a holding area for new kid on the blocks where they can relax prior to being introduced to the group.

Ask how a facility screens for safety threats like kennel coughing, and what their inoculation needs are. Accountable day cares will only allow healthy and balanced pets right into their groups.

Many large centers will certainly have long term dog boarding personnel enjoy each canine for a few mins upon arrival and throughout the day to examine exactly how they're managing other dogs. This permits team to swiftly find health and behavior problems such as extreme barking or resource guarding. They need to additionally be able to interact this information to their pet dog proprietors, helping them make notified decisions concerning their pet dog's daily care.

Sanitation
Canine daycare can be a great means to supply canines with socialization, workout, and psychological stimulation while their proprietors are at work. Nonetheless, it is very important to maintain high criteria of sanitation in the facility to ensure pet health and wellness.

One of one of the most typical sources of smell is pee and fecal matter. These products create ammonia gas that can irritate the eyes and lungs of pet dogs close. Proper hygiene includes prompt elimination and disposal of waste, followed by decontaminating and purging the area with a lot of fresh water.

It's additionally essential to use cleansing products made for animal centers. Chlorine-based or sped up hydrogen peroxide products can assault and destroy surface areas, making them less effective at eliminating germs and smells. Furthermore, overly focused disinfectant options can be irritating to skin and mucous membrane layers. The best cleaner will certainly be simple to collaborate with, risk-free for people and animals and leave kennels and rooms gleaming clean.

Team Training
Water: Personnel needs to inspect and clean the pet dog's water bowl typically. This helps pet dogs stay hydrated and prevents bacterial infections.

Vaccinations: Make sure all family pets have up-to-date inoculations. This protects the pet dogs in the daycare and protects against spread of disease to various other canines.

Actions Management: The center's staff need to be trained in pet body language and habits, as well as techniques to maintain canines happy and tranquil. This consists of grouping pets according to size and power degree and separating them if they do not get along.

Enrichment and Socializing: The daycare must provide interactive playthings, training workouts, and enrichment activities for each and every dog to maintain them boosted and to prevent dullness and bad habits. Team ought to likewise be educated to observe and acknowledge indicators of tension or overstimulation, consisting of climbing hackles, tucked stories, cowed hunching, and gazing. They need to know exactly how to take care of these behaviors swiftly and securely. They ought to additionally be able to interact with family pet proprietors routinely to upgrade them on just how their dog is doing and to talk about any kind of concerns.
